Transaction 696c68c9aa58ca187128bb50bbbc3bf14c3e5c998dbb1c7545a43f983ce9ee59
1 Input
1 Output
-
696c68c9aa58ca187128bb50bbbc3bf14c3e5c998dbb1c7545a43f983ce9ee59:0
- value
- 95309
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e73435ec8cb926bee82a8efdf4fb9dd077c9a66 OP_EQUAL
- address
- 331RTrWkSfQUi936fRevzfWMNzM1rk9S12